Choosing an asbestos case Attorney

A mesothelioma lawsuit can pay for funeral expenses, and income loss. It can also include compensations for pain and suffering.

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er will determine the most effective type of asbestos claim (on front page) to file. National firms can file lawsuits in cases where asbestos exposure occurred in several states.

Find a firm that practices all over the world.

The law firm you select should be experienced in representing clients across all 50 states. This is essential because mesothelioma cases can be a bit complicated and requires the investigation of a victim's employment history and linking it to asbestos exposure incidents, some of which occurred in a variety of states. A law firm with a nationwide practice will have access to national resources, including a network of mesothelioma experts.

Find a firm that Works on a Contingency Basis

It is important to choose the best asbestos lawyer for your situation. You need a lawyer with experience, a solid track record and a favorable reputation. When evaluating potential lawyers, you should also consider their fees and charges. Most asbestos lawyers work on a contingency basis meaning that they will only receive a fee when they are able to resolve your case. Lawyers who work on a contingency fee typically charge between 30 and 40% of the compensation you receive. However, it's important to remember that just a few percentage points of your settlement should not determine whether or not you choose to work with an attorney.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will ensure that you are informed about your rights and the procedure of filing a lawsuit or claim through an asbestos trust fund. They will help identify individuals who may be liable for the asbestos exposure you've endured, including asbestos settlement manufacturers, trust funds, insurance companies, and trust funds. They will also assist you to determine the worth of your claim and help you obtain medical records and other evidence to prove your asbestos-related ailments.
